A Brief History of Chariotry
Chariot races were a keystone feature of the poluss heritage. But militarily too, they had long served an important role this way of warfare. Stationed hind the front line, the chariots functioned as fast moving troop transports. Four of the city's famous horses pulled a semi protected cabin capable of carrying three passengers. At the forefront was the driver, expert at guiding his four horse team across the battlefield. Supporting him were two infantry soldiers, the real teeth of the team, wielding spear bow or javelin.
